Como instalacion joomlahttp

Solo disponible en BuenasTareas
  • Páginas : 6 (1262 palabras )
  • Descarga(s) : 0
  • Publicado : 19 de septiembre de 2010
Leer documento completo
Vista previa del texto
CNICE

CÓMO- Instalar Joomla!
Proceso de instalación de este gestor de contenidos en Linux

José Alejandro del Pozo Peralta Dept. de Telemática 12 de Julio de 2006

ÍNDICE
1.2.Requisitos mínimos Proceso de instalación en Linux 2.1.- Conseguir los fuentes 2.2.- Descomprimir fuentes 2.3.- Modificación fichero configuración Apache 2.4.- Instalación vía Web 2.4.1.- Preinstalación 2.4.2.-Acuerdo de licencia 2.4.3.- Paso 1 . Configuración servidor MySQL 2.4.4.- Paso 2 2.4.5.- Paso 3 . Confirmación de varios datos 2.4.6.- Paso 4 Referencias

3.-

1.- Requisitos mínimos
• • • PHP 4.2.x o posterior MySQL 3.23.x o posterior Apache 1.13.19 o posterior

Además, tenemos que asegurarnos que el intérprete PHP para Apache tenga soporte para XML, MySQL y Zlib. Esto lo podemos comprobarutilizando la función predefinida phpinfo(). Lo vemos.

2.- Proceso de instalación en Linux
2.1.- Conseguir los fuentes
Los podemos conseguir de la página oficial http://developer.joomla.org/ o, alternativamente del sitio español de joomla! http://www.joomlaspanish.org/. NOTA: si elegimos descargarnos los fuentes del site español, tendremos estar registrados (el registro es gratuito). Ennuestro caso, nos hemos bajado la versión 1.0.8 traducida al español de joomlaspanish.org.

2.2.- Descomprimir fuentes
NOTA: en nuestro caso lo instalaremos en la máquina ****, para que tengan acceso los cuatro servidores Web de las cuatro máquinas **** para su directorio común **** 1. Descomprimimos nuestro archivo Joomla_1.0.8-spanish-premium.zip en, por ejemplo: /tmp/Joomla. Lo vemos.
[root@****Joomla]# unzip Joomla_1.0.8-spanish-premium.zip Archive: Joomla_1.0.8-spanish-premium.zip inflating: INSTALL.php inflating: LICENSE.php inflating: mainbody.php inflating: offline.php inflating: offlinebar.php inflating: pathway.php inflating: robots.txt …. inflating: htaccess.txt inflating: index.php

inflating: index2.php

2. Seguidamente, movemos todo el contenido de /tmp/Joomla a una rutaespecificada en nuestro archivo de configuración de Apache. En nuestro caso, lo ubicaremos en /****/***/agora2006. Lo vemos.
[root@**** Joomla]# mv * /****/***/agora2006

2.3.- Modificación fichero configuración Apache
Ahora, necesitaremos modificar el fichero de configuración del servidor Web Apache, situado comúnmente en /etc/httpd/httpd.conf. Lo vemos. Archivo de configuración de Apache.NameVirtualHost *:80 DocumentRoot "/****/PaginaInicial" php_admin_value open_basedir /****/***/:/tmp/:/usr/local/:/****/ArchivosBancos/GTM/ ServerName ****.mec.es ..... ..... #Linea nueva añadida Alias /agora2006 "/****/***/agora2006" .....

NOTA: hay que modificar el fichero de configuración de apache para las 4 máquinas **** (de la 1 a la 4). Para ello utilizaremos el script apacheconfubicado en la máquina **** (para una “modificación centralizada”). Proceso: 1. Nos situamos en /***** y, 2. Ejecutamos apacheconf. Lo vemos.
[sistemas@**** ****]$apacheconf httpd.conf La ruta local y definitiva es: /****/ La ruta remota definitiva es: /****/ httpd.conf 100% 00:00 |**************************************************************************| 59454 Se copió correctamente el fichero"httpd.conf" en /****/ Se ha hecho una copia de seguridad en: /****/ConfiguracionAnterior/ ……

2.4.- Instalación vía Web
2.4.1.- Preinstalación Una vez instalado Joomla, veremos la pantalla de preinstalación si ponemos en nuestro navegador http://****/agora2006

Esta pantalla está dividida en 3 secciones, para la comprobación de algunos parámetros. 1ª sección Es importante verificar que nuestraversión de PHP sea la 4.1.0 o superior, con soporte para Zlib, XML y MySQL.

2ª sección Estado recomendable de algunos parámetros del fichero php.ini para el funcionamiento correcto de Joomla.

3ª Sección Permisos sobre directorios y ficheros. Es NECESARIO tener permisos sobre algunos directorios y ficheros, para que la instalación se realice adecuadamente.

Si algún directorio/fichero “No...
tracking img